Non-production-stop fettling device for calcining furnace
By designing a furnace repair device that allows the calcining furnace to be repaired without interrupting production, a mobile frame and stirring components were used to achieve repairs without interrupting production, solving the problem of production line interruption, improving production efficiency and reducing costs.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of furnace repairing device, especially to calcining furnace non-stop production furnace repairing device. BACKGROUND
[0002] The calcining furnace is a kind of high-temperature heating treatment thermal equipment for powder or filter cake material, also called calcination furnace, which is widely used in many industries and fields, such as metallurgy, chemical industry, steel, cement production, petrochemical industry, waste treatment, etc., for ironmaking, recycling of rare metals, catalyst production, environmental improvement, production of special chemical products, etc.
[0003] In the prior art, when the calcining furnace needs to be repaired, the production line is completely interrupted and the product cannot be produced, resulting in a significant decrease in production efficiency, and the calcining furnace needs to be cooled, cleaned and prepared for a long time, and additional fuel and time are needed to restart the calcining furnace to reach a stable operating state, which will increase the production cost, so the calcining furnace non-stop production furnace repairing device needs to be improved to solve the above problems. [0026] During operation, the push-pull rod 5 moves the entire assembly to the desired location. Then, repair material is added to the mixing tank 21 via the feed valve 22. At this point, the motor 33 is started, driving the long shaft 34 to rotate inside the worm gear 211. This rotates the three sets of stirring blades 36 via the fixed sleeve 35, ensuring thorough mixing of the repair material in the mixing tank 21. Next, the pump body 23 is started, discharging the repair material from the mixing tank 21 through the first connecting hose 24. The repair mixture is then sprayed from the nozzle 225 through the second connecting hose 26 and the rigid pipe 224, evenly applying the repair material to the area requiring repair.
